Best Quotes about Acting and actors
The thing about performance, even if it's only an illusion, is that it is a celebration of the fact that we do contain within ourselves infinite possibilities.
Lewis, Daniel Day
Actors are one family over the entire world.
Woodard, Alfre
The basic essential of a great actor is that he loves himself in acting.
Chaplin, Charlie
I am the Fred Astaire of karate.
Damme, Jean-Claude Van
The best actors do not let the wheels show.
Fonda, Henry
An actor is only merchandise.
Chow Yun-Fat
Show me a great actor and I'll show you a lousy husband. Show me a great actress, and you've seen the devil.
Fields, W. C.
I don't want to read about some of these actresses who are around today. They sound like my niece in Scarsdale. I love my niece in Scarsdale, but I won't buy tickets to see her act.
Price, Vincent
The mug is a tool. My ace in the hole. To have looks is the bonus on top of what motivates me to be an actor. Not to realize they're an asset would be counterproductive to the cause; they serve the common good.
Zane, Billy
Insecurity, commonly regarded as a weakness in normal people, is the basic tool of the actor's trade.
Richardson, Miranda
I don't think there's a punch-line scheduled, is there?
Python, Monty
The main factor in any form of creativeness is the life of a human spirit, that of the actor and his part, their joint feelings and subconscious creation.
Stanislavisky, Konstantin
Acting is a question of absorbing other people's personalities and adding some of your own experience.
Newman, Paul
The most minor gifts and not a very high class way to earn a living. After all, Shirley Temple could do it at the age of four.
Hepburn, Katharine
To grasp the full significance of life is the actor's duty, to interpret it is his problem, and to express it his dedication.
Brando, Marlon
The actor becomes an emotional athlete. The process is painful -- my personal life suffers.
Pacino, Al
I don't get acting jobs because of my looks.
Baldwin, Alec
I really think that effective acting has to do literally with the movement of molecules.
Close, Glenn
The actors today really need the whip hand. They're so lazy. They haven't got the sense of pride in their profession that the less socially elevated musical comedy and music hall people or acrobats have. The theater has never been any good since the actors became gentlemen.
Auden, W. H.
When I was a fireman I was in a lot of burning buildings. It was a great job, the only job I ever had that compares with the thrill of acting. Before going into a fire, there's the same surge of adrenaline you get just before the camera rolls.
Buscemi, Steve
If you give an audience a chance they will do half your acting for you.
Hepburn, Katharine
A lot of what acting is paying attention.
Redford, Robert
I have spent more than half a lifetime trying to express the tragic moment.
Marceau, Marcel
I am acquainted with no immaterial sensuality so delightful as good acting.
Byron, Lord
An actor is a guy who, if you ain't talking about him, he ain't listening.
Glass, George
From '86 until the summer of last year, wherever I went, people would say, You would have made a great James Bond! Weren't you going to be James Bond? You should have been, you could have been, you may have been. Yes, yes, yes, yes, yes. It was like unfinished business in my life. I couldn't say no to it this time around.
Brosnan, Pierce
I'm an assistant storyteller. It's like being a waiter or a gas-station attendant, but I'm waiting on six million people a week, if I'm lucky. [On being an actor]
Ford, Harrison
Acting is a matter of giving away secrets.
Barkin, Ellen
Remember: there are no small parts, only small actors.
Stanislavisky, Konstantin
Until Ace Ventura, no actor had considered talking through his ass.
Carrey, Jim
Actors are loved because they are unoriginal. Actors stick to their script. The unoriginal man is loved by the mediocrity because this kind of artistic expression is something to which the merest five-eighth can climb.
Kavanagh, Patrick
Somebody told me I should put a pebble in my mouth to cure my stuttering. Well, I tried it, and during a scene I swallowed the pebble. That was the end of that.
Davies, Marion
I'm not an actress who can create a character. I play me.
Moore, Mary Tyler
In Europe an actor is an artist. In Hollywood, if he isn't working, he's a bum.
Quinn, Anthony
In civilized life, where the happiness and indeed almost the existence of man, depends on the opinion of his fellow men. He is constantly acting a studied part.
Irving, Washington
Why, except as a means of livelihood, a man should desire to act on the stage when he has the whole world to act in, is not clear to me.
Shaw, George Bernard
A man who strains himself on the stage is bound, if he is any good, to strain all the people sitting in the stalls.
Brecht, Bertolt
One forgets too easily the difference between a man and his image, and that there is none between the sound of his voice on the screen and in real life.
Bresson, Robert
A good many dramatic situations begin with screaming.
Fonda, Jane
You name it and I've done it. I'd like to say I did it my way. But that line, I'm afraid, belongs to someone else.
Davis Jr., Sammy
Actors die so loud.
Miller, Henry
I find myself fascinating.
Dreyfus, Richard
A movie camera is like having someone you have a crush on watching you from afar-- you pretend it's not there.
Hannah, Daryl
An actor who knows his business ought to be able to make the London telephone directory sound enthralling.
Sinden, Donald
It's not a field, I think, for people who need to have success every day: if you can't live with a nightly sort of disaster, you should get out. I wouldn't describe myself as lacking in confidence, but I would just say that the ghosts you chase you never catch.
Malkovich, John
Acting on a good idea is better than just having a good idea.
Half, Robert
Some people are addicts. If they don't act, they don't exist.
Moreau, Jeanne
The most difficult character in comedy is that of the fool, and he must be no simpleton that plays that part.
Cervantes, Miguel De
I can't tell you how many shows I've done with full-blown migraine headaches.
Thomas, Jonathan Taylor
There were many times my pants were so thin I could sit on a dime and tell if it was heads or tails.
Tracy, Spencer
